Description Project Solutions Group served as a consultant to the landlord, Vornado, in this 9,000 square foot renovation of Arlington County’s Network Operation Center. PSG was hired to assist the Vornado Construction Division to provide technical guidance and alleviate some of the workload. The existing NOC power and cooling were insufficient and the older
equipment presented quite a few logistical and operational challenges. The Project Team was faced with installing major equipment to cover the past few years of growth and also future expansion. They were also confronted with very limited pathways, opened shaft walls and engineer revised piping specs. Some of the key factors during the project were the engineering design and review, the equipment selection phase and review of new equipment. The Team selection was critical to ensure the workforce and knowledge was available at every level to meet the design to completion schedule. Work included:
• Replacing the generator • Replacing and upsizing fuel tanks • Replacing cooling (HVAC) • Data center supports Arlington County’s TV stations, dispatch (911), county
functions such as accounting & revenue tracking By negotiating pricing and change order control PSG was successful in reducing the costs of this project. The team provided technical submittal review and insisted and qualified the use of MOP’s on all critical activities. Completion 2008

Description Capital One Auto Finance (COAF) needed expanded call center capabilities. After an exhaustive search, COAF selected an existing 80,000 SF occupied Mod within the Verizon Campus in Tulsa, Oklahoma. This group needed to be up and running by October 3, 2006 with 150 seats, adding 50 seats every two weeks until total capacity of 650 was achieved.
PSG served as overall Project Manager on this fast track assignment – coordinating the redesign of the existing furniture system, establishing redundant infrastructure systems, managing the construction of IDF’s and MDF for early occupancy, and overseeing general construction of offices, training rooms and conference rooms. This work was managed around occupied space as the previous tenant did not vacate until August 28, 2006. PSG managed the landlord, architect, engineer
and furniture vendor to best utilize the space, existing product, and current UPS systems. We also met a “go live” date and made certain the project stayed within a limited development budget. This was a design/build/furnish project. In addition, PSG coordinated the activities of COAF’s internal IT team in the roll out of network/telecom and desktop install. Other achievements included:
Time and cost was saved by capitalizing the redesign and re-installation of existing furniture inventory.
Instead of a complete redesign of the infrastructure system, a modified system was
utilized to capture existing value.
Long lead time material was ordered before final design.
Integrated design/build team approach was utilized from the project start, which allowed for early delivery of revenue producing space under the original budget.
Completion 2006

Description Continuous change and growth in the international cellular communications market required NII Holdings, Inc. to rapidly grow beyond the capacity of their current office space and associated Data Center. NII engaged PSG in what amounted to over two years of combined planning and execution to relocate their entire operation and operating Data Center to a completely new facility incorporating high end corporate office space and a 24/7, N+1 level facility.
The requirement from NII to have corporate office space in the same facility as the Data Center presented quite a few logistical and operational challenges. The Project Team was faced with installing major equipment in a building designed specifically for typical tenant / office type space. To further complicate the project, the building chosen by NII resides in the middle of a major Town Center with very limited available space and strict noise and aesthetic concerns by the Property Manager. A challenge felt during the entire project was ongoing base building construction and the daily coordination with the base building team. The use of only one, medium sized freight elevator, utilized by hundreds or workers daily required daily planning for movement of even the most standard materials. PSG worked with NII to assemble the Design and Construction Team, down to the level of MEP subcontractor selection. The Team selection was critical to ensure the workforce and knowledge was available at every level to meet the 16 week design to completion schedule. Work included:
• Specifying and pre-purchasing the new electrical and mechanical equipment for the Data Center thus eliminating up to thirty week lead time component from the schedule.
• Pre-purchasing several major data center components through PSG’s proprietary National
Purchasing Program, reducing original budgeted costs.
• Extensive communication and negotiation with the Property Manager / Developer to allow for placement of a generator, separate fuel tank and delivery system and HVAC roof-top equipment.
The complete 75,000sf and associated Data Center project was delivered on schedule and the Data Center Network infrastructure was migrated successfully over a very narrow maintenance window allowing NII the ability to be fully operational as planned, with no interruption in normal operating business hours. Completion March 2008

Description Space planning and existing building conditions were leading considerations in XO Communications decision to relocate their corporate headquarters office and network facility in the Northern Virginia area. XO reached out to PSG after having relied on PSG’s assistance for many years, to help them through the complete Real Estate services requirements, followed closely by the design and build out of their new
corporate office space and related Network / Data Center facility. XO was limited in their flexibility to locate their Network Facility remotely and ultimately decided to integrate the Data Center within their new Tenant space. The property presented numerous challenges as the building chosen by XO was built for standard tenant type office space, not a fully functioning redundant Data Center. PSG worked closely with the Property Management Company as the building is a multi – tenant Class A facility where any noise and other tenant interruptions were not an option. There were very limited options to locate a new generator and through many discussions, a mutually acceptable location was found, which minimized impact to the facility and located the generator close to the building, reducing construction related costs and time on the schedule. The Design and Construction Team selection process included the variables of finding companies whose talents and experience included both Fast-Track High-End Tenant and Mission Critical experience. PSG researched numerous companies and presented the best of the best and the up-front research paid off with excellent communication and coordination by the entire team, which allowed the project to come in on time and under budget. In addition to the normal Project Management process, our challenges included:
• Combined pre-purchase of all long lead items (Tenant & Data Center) requiring additional up-front design time, but saving many weeks off of the construction schedule.
• Pre-purchasing several major data center components through PSG’s proprietary National Purchasing Program, reducing original budgeted costs.
• Daily consideration of the existing tenants to minimize any evidence of Construction related activity both outside and inside the building. Working with the Property Manager closely and scheduling and completing major underground utility work with no disruption to auto or pedestrian traffic.
The 100,000sf tenant build out which incorporated the Data Center was completed in advance of the original expected time frame. PSG’s ability to provide oversight and guidance from the point of space consideration, through and including the move management of all personnel, as well as continuing facility maintenance allowed XO to concentrate on their ongoing business activities during the entire process with very little distraction. Completion October 2007
